
2018 HARDYS CHAR NO.3 Shiraz
2018 saw a typically warm and dry growing season in McLaren Vale with temperatures generally 1 degree Celsius above average.
Spring rains brought good growth and soil moisture out of a relatively dry winter. January and February saw near ideal conditions deliver Shiraz with intense colour and flavour development. Mild conditions extended during March allowing harvest to occur at optimal ripeness.
Rich vibrant dark fruits of blackberry, plum and black cherries balanced by the generous rich texture of charred oak barrels and velvety tannins. Layered use of French oak adding to the roundness and complexity of the wine.
